The sky is basically a colour
gradient on the Y axis (vertical). Povray provides a sky_sphere
declaration for
this purpose. A gradient is a kind of "pigment" in the Povray language.
The gradient is applied on the sky_sphere
object. An example coming from mountains.pov
is shown at right (X rotation=355°, angle of view = 55°). So,

(shown) or in sea_and_rocks.pov.| Version 0.40 and later The height field should now be declared like this: #declare hf = height_field { png main_terrain ... "main_terrain" is a variable created in geomorph.inc. It contains the name of the current height field file, if it has been saved, or test.png, if not. The file also declares variables containing secondary height fields, like "water_map", "background_map", "ground_map" and "crater_map", for some scripts requiring them. |
